Output e8982544a2486de617a162719fa291ca74fa8a5dc66b63ebe348333c48f5f2e8:1

value
596660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fa4035462608309b01500a1b85725c38a6aa99f OP_EQUAL
address
3KAKU1MDnW2gvjb7xsQoS8hGsVzmrgZ45D
transaction
e8982544a2486de617a162719fa291ca74fa8a5dc66b63ebe348333c48f5f2e8
spent
true